Mahogany Too is an intriguing revival that plays off the original 1975 classic with a fresh lens. The film dives deep into the world of Tracy Chambers, played once again with that same complex blend of ambition and vulnerability that Diana Ross nailed back in the day. The use of analogue film really brings out those vintage tones, adding a layer of nostalgia that feels almost tactile. Pacing is slow but deliberate, giving us time to soak in the rich atmosphere of the fashion world while exploring themes of identity and ambition. The performances, though not from the original cast, resonate with a depth that makes you reconsider the journey of the character. It’s a fascinating exploration that keeps you engaged throughout.
